Co-operation and scaling up accelerating sustainable development of the textile industry

Co-operation and scaling up accelerating sustainable development of the textile industry

Gathering over 100 textile industry experts, Nordic Textile Fibre Day explored the latest developments in man-made cellulosic textile fibers and textile recycling. Scaling up from pilot phase to industrial production, funding the investment and development and close co-operation between different companies and start-ups are seen essential to transform the textile industry towards more sustainable way of working. AFH products: trends, challenges, and the Perini Proxima S6 rewinder solution

AFH products: trends, challenges, and the Perini Proxima S6 rewinder solution

Away-from-home (AFH) products have become one of the most widely used commodities in the world. It’s estimated that nearly one-third of the tissue market — about 21 million tons of tissue paper every year —  is currently designated specifically to AFH.
